从云端到边缘:云计算演进与边缘计算的协同革命

一、云计算的发展历程与技术演进

1.1 萌芽期(2006-2010):概念验证与基础设施构建

2006年AWS推出EC2服务,标志着云计算从理论走向实践。此阶段核心特征包括:

  • 虚拟化技术突破:VMware等厂商实现硬件资源池化,为多租户隔离奠定基础
  • 按需付费模式:突破传统IT采购的资本支出(CapEx)模式,转向运营支出(OpEx)
  • 基础服务成型:提供计算(EC2)、存储(S3)、数据库(RDS)等IaaS服务

典型案例:Dropbox早期完全基于AWS S3构建存储系统,通过弹性扩展应对用户爆发式增长,验证了云计算的可行性。

1.2 成长期(2011-2015):平台服务与行业渗透

此阶段云计算向PaaS和SaaS延伸,形成完整服务栈:

  • PaaS兴起:Google App Engine、Heroku等平台降低开发门槛,支持全托管应用部署
  • 混合云架构:VMware vCloud、Azure Stack等解决方案解决企业数据主权问题
  • 行业解决方案:AWS推出针对金融、医疗等行业的合规云服务

技术突破点:容器技术的萌芽(Docker 2013年发布)为后续微服务架构奠定基础,但此时尚未形成主流。

1.3 成熟期(2016-至今):智能化与多云战略

当前云计算呈现三大趋势:

  • AI即服务:AWS SageMaker、Azure ML等平台提供端到端机器学习流水线
  • Serverless架构:AWS Lambda、Google Cloud Functions实现代码级自动扩展
  • 多云管理:Terraform、Kubernetes等工具支持跨云资源编排

数据佐证:Gartner报告显示,2023年全球云计算市场规模达$5,953亿,其中IaaS占比45%,PaaS增长最快(年复合增长率22%)。

二、边缘计算的崛起背景与技术特性

2.1 驱动因素分析

边缘计算的产生源于三大矛盾:

  • 时延敏感需求:自动驾驶(<10ms)、工业控制(<1ms)等场景无法容忍云端往返时延
  • 带宽成本压力:4K/8K视频监控产生TB级数据,全部上传云端成本高昂
  • 数据隐私法规:GDPR等法规要求敏感数据本地处理

2.2 技术架构解析

边缘计算典型架构包含三层:

  1. 终端设备层(IoT传感器、摄像头)
  2. 边缘节点层(网关、微型数据中心)
  3. 云端管理层(资源调度、全局分析)

关键技术指标:

  • 计算密度:单节点支持100+并发AI推理
  • 网络带宽:5G/Wi-Fi 6提供Gbps级连接
  • 能效比:NVIDIA Jetson系列实现30TOPS/W的AI计算

2.3 与云计算的对比

维度 云计算 边缘计算
部署位置 集中式数据中心 靠近数据源的分布式节点
计算资源 弹性扩展(万级节点) 有限资源(单节点4-16核)
典型时延 50-200ms 1-20ms
数据处理方式 批量处理为主 流式处理为主

三、云计算与边缘计算的协同实践

3.1 典型应用场景

场景1:智能制造

  • 云端:训练缺陷检测模型(ResNet50,98%准确率)
  • 边缘:部署轻量模型(MobileNetV3,<50MB)实现实时质检
  • 效果:某汽车工厂减少30%次品率,网络带宽需求降低75%

场景2:智慧城市

  • 云端:全局交通流量优化(强化学习算法)
  • 边缘:路口摄像头本地决策(YOLOv5目标检测)
  • 案例:杭州城市大脑项目,通过云边协同使通行效率提升15%

3.2 技术实现路径

  1. 资源调度层:使用Kubernetes Edge实现容器跨云边部署
    1. apiVersion: edge.k8s.io/v1
    2. kind: EdgeDeployment
    3. metadata:
    4. name: ai-inference
    5. spec:
    6. template:
    7. spec:
    8. nodeSelector:
    9. kubernetes.io/hostname: edge-node-01
    10. containers:
    11. - name: model-server
    12. image: tensorflow/serving:latest
    13. resources:
    14. limits:
    15. nvidia.com/gpu: 1
  2. 数据同步层:采用Delta Lake实现云边数据增量同步
  3. 安全架构:实施零信任模型,边缘节点通过SPIFFE ID进行身份认证

3.3 实施建议

  1. 分阶段落地

    • 阶段1:边缘数据预处理(过滤、压缩)
    • 阶段2:边缘轻量推理(目标检测、OCR)
    • 阶段3:边缘训练(联邦学习)
  2. 供应商选择标准

    • 硬件兼容性:支持ARM/x86混合部署
    • 管理界面:统一云边管理控制台
    • 协议标准:兼容MQTT、CoAP等物联网协议
  3. 成本优化策略

    • 边缘节点采用二手企业级服务器(成本降低40%)
    • 动态负载调度:空闲边缘节点承接附近区域任务

四、未来展望与挑战

4.1 技术融合趋势

  • 云边端一体化:AWS Snow Family、Azure Stack Edge等设备实现计算连续体
  • AI原生架构:边缘芯片(如Intel Myriad X)集成专用AI加速器
  • 数字孪生:边缘实时数据驱动云端数字模型更新

4.2 待解决问题

  1. 标准缺失:云边协同缺乏统一API标准(当前主要依赖厂商定制)
  2. 安全风险:边缘节点暴露在开放环境,易受物理攻击
  3. 运维复杂度:某能源企业案例显示,云边架构使运维工作量增加2.3倍

4.3 企业决策框架

建议采用”3C评估模型”:

  • Connectivity(连接性):评估网络可靠性(SLA 99.9% vs 99.99%)
  • Compute(计算):测算边缘节点CPU利用率(建议<70%)
  • Cost(成本):计算TCO(3年周期对比全云方案)

结语

云计算与边缘计算的协同正在重塑IT架构范式。Gartner预测,到2025年将有超过50%的企业数据在边缘侧处理。对于开发者而言,掌握云边协同技术栈(如K3s轻量Kubernetes、ONNX模型转换)将成为核心竞争力。建议企业从POC项目起步,逐步构建适应未来需求的分布式计算能力。